Medical uses

Brexanolone is used to treat postpartum depression in adult women, administered as a continuous intravenous infusion over a period of 60 hours, and essential tremor.


Clinical efficacy

Women experiencing moderate to severe postpartum depression when treated with a single dose of intravenous brexanolone display a significant reduction in HAM-D scores which persisted 30 days post-treatment.

Mechanism of action


Molecular interactions

Allopregnanolone is an
endogenous Endogeny, in biology, refers to the property of originating or developing from within an organism, tissue, or cell. For example, ''endogenous substances'', and ''endogenous processes'' are those that originate within a living system (e.g. an ...
inhibitory An inhibitory postsynaptic potential (IPSP) is a kind of synaptic potential that makes a Chemical synapse, postsynaptic neuron less likely to generate an action potential.Purves et al. Neuroscience. 4th ed. Sunderland (MA): Sinauer Associates, Inc ...
pregnane neurosteroid. It is made from pregnenolone, and is a positive allosteric modulator of the action of γ-aminobutyric acid (GABA) at GABAA receptor. Allopregnanolone has effects similar to those of other positive allosteric modulators of the GABA action at GABAA receptor such as the
benzodiazepine Benzodiazepines (BZD, BDZ, BZs), colloquially known as "benzos", are a class of central nervous system (CNS) depressant, depressant drugs whose core chemical structure is the fusion of a benzene ring and a diazepine ring. They are prescribed t ...
s, including anxiolytic, sedative, and anticonvulsant activity. Endogenously produced allopregnanolone exerts a neurophysiological role by fine-tuning of GABAA receptor and modulating the action of several positive allosteric modulators and agonists at GABAA receptor. Allopregnanolone acts as a highly potent positive allosteric modulator of the GABAA receptor. While allopregnanolone, like other inhibitory neurosteroids such as THDOC, positively modulates all GABAA receptor isoforms, those isoforms containing δ subunits exhibit the greatest potentiation. Allopregnanolone has also been found to act as a positive allosteric modulator of the GABAA-ρ receptor, though the implications of this action are unclear. In addition to its actions on GABA receptors, allopregnanolone, like progesterone, is known to be a negative allosteric modulator of nACh receptors, and also appears to act as a negative allosteric modulator of the 5-HT3 receptor. The action of allopregnanolone at these receptors may be related, in part, to its neuroprotective and antigonadotropic properties. Also like progesterone, recent evidence has shown that allopregnanolone is an activator of the pregnane X receptor. Similarly to many other GABAA receptor positive allosteric modulators, allopregnanolone has been found to act as an
inhibitor Inhibitor or inhibition may refer to: Biology * Enzyme inhibitor, a substance that binds to an enzyme and decreases the enzyme's activity * Reuptake inhibitor, a substance that increases neurotransmission by blocking the reuptake of a neurotransmi ...
of L-type voltage-gated calcium channels (L-VGCCs), including α1 subtypes Cav1.2 and Cav1.3. However, the threshold concentration of allopregnanolone to inhibit L-VGCCs was determined to be 3 μM (3,000 nM), which is far greater than the concentration of 5 nM that has been estimated to be naturally produced in the human brain. Thus, inhibition of L-VGCCs is unlikely of any actual significance in the effects of endogenous allopregnanolone. Also, allopregnanolone, along with several other neurosteroids, has been found to activate the G protein-coupled bile acid receptor (GPBAR1, or TGR5). However, it is only able to do so at micromolar concentrations, which, similarly to the case of the L-VGCCs, are far greater than the low nanomolar concentrations of allopregnanolone estimated to be present in the brain.


Biphasic actions at the GABAA receptor

Increased levels of allopregnanolone can produce paradoxical effects, including negative mood, anxiety,
irritability Irritability is the excitatory ability that living organisms have to respond to changes in their environment. The term is used for both the physiological reaction to stimuli and for the pathological, abnormal or excessive sensitivity to stimul ...
, and
aggression Aggression is behavior aimed at opposing or attacking something or someone. Though often done with the intent to cause harm, some might channel it into creative and practical outlets. It may occur either reactively or without provocation. In h ...
. This appears to be because allopregnanolone possesses biphasic, U-shaped actions at the GABAA receptor – moderate level increases (in the range of 1.5–2 nmol/L total allopregnanolone, which are approximately equivalent to
luteal phase The menstrual cycle is on average 28 days in length. It begins with Menstruation, menses (day 1–7) during the follicular phase (day 1–14), followed by ovulation (day 14) and ending with the luteal phase (day 14–28). While historically, medi ...
levels) inhibit the activity of the receptor, while lower and higher concentration increases stimulate it. This seems to be a common effect of many GABAA receptor positive allosteric modulators. In accordance, acute administration of low doses of micronized progesterone (which reliably elevates allopregnanolone levels) has been found to have negative effects on mood, while higher doses have a neutral effect.


Antidepressant effects

The mechanism by which neurosteroid GABAA receptor positive allosteric modulators (PAMs) like brexanolone have antidepressant effects is unknown. Other GABAA receptor PAMs, such as
benzodiazepine Benzodiazepines (BZD, BDZ, BZs), colloquially known as "benzos", are a class of central nervous system (CNS) depressant, depressant drugs whose core chemical structure is the fusion of a benzene ring and a diazepine ring. They are prescribed t ...
s, are not thought of as antidepressants and have no proven efficacy, although
alprazolam Alprazolam, sold under the brand name Xanax among others, is a fast-acting, potent tranquilizer of moderate duration within the triazolobenzodiazepine group of chemicals called benzodiazepines. Alprazolam is most commonly prescribed in the ...
has historically been prescribed for depression. Neurosteroid GABAA receptor PAMs are known to interact with GABAA receptors and subpopulations differently than benzodiazepines. GABAA receptor-potentiating neurosteroids may preferentially target δ-subunit–containing GABAA receptors, and enhance both tonic and phasic inhibition mediated by GABAA receptors. It is possible that neurosteroids like allopregnanolone may act on other targets, including membrane progesterone receptors, T-type voltage-gated calcium channels, and others, to mediate antidepressant effects.

Chemistry

Allopregnanolone is a pregnane (C21)
steroid A steroid is an organic compound with four fused compound, fused rings (designated A, B, C, and D) arranged in a specific molecular configuration. Steroids have two principal biological functions: as important components of cell membranes t ...
and is also known as 5α-pregnan-3α-ol-20-one, 5α-pregnane-3α-ol-20-one, 3α-hydroxy-5α-pregnan-20-one, or 3α,5α-tetrahydroprogesterone (3α,5α-THP). It is closely related structurally to 5-pregnenolone (pregn-5-en-3β-ol-20-dione), progesterone (pregn-4-ene-3,20-dione), the isomers of pregnanedione (5-dihydroprogesterone; 5-pregnane-3,20-dione), the isomers of 4-pregnenolone (3-dihydroprogesterone; pregn-4-en-3-ol-20-one), and the isomers of pregnanediol (5-pregnane-3,20-diol). In addition, allopregnanolone is one of four isomers of pregnanolone (3,5-tetrahydroprogesterone), with the other three isomers being pregnanolone (5β-pregnan-3α-ol-20-one), isopregnanolone (5α-pregnan-3β-ol-20-one), and epipregnanolone (5β-pregnan-3β-ol-20-one).

History

In March 2019, brexanolone was approved in the United States for the treatment of postpartum depression (PPD) in adult women, the first drug approved by the U.S.
Food and Drug Administration The United States Food and Drug Administration (FDA or US FDA) is a List of United States federal agencies, federal agency of the United States Department of Health and Human Services, Department of Health and Human Services. The FDA is respo ...
(FDA) specifically for PPD. The efficacy of brexanolone was shown in two clinical studies of participants who received a 60-hour continuous intravenous infusion of brexanolone or placebo and were then followed for four weeks. The FDA approved allopregnanolone based on evidence from three clinical trials, conducted in the United States, (Trial 1/NCT02942004, Trial 3/NCT02614541, Trial 2/ NCT02942017) of 247 women with moderate or severe postpartum depression. The FDA granted the application for brexanolone priority review and breakthrough therapy designations, and granted approval of Zulresso to Sage Therapeutics, Inc.


Society and culture


Names

Brexanolone is both the International Nonproprietary Name and the United States Adopted Name in the context of its use as a medication. Zulresso is a brand name of the medication.


Legal status

In the United States, brexanolone is a Schedule IV controlled substance.

Research

Brexanolone was under development as an intravenously administered medication for the treatment of
major depressive disorder Major depressive disorder (MDD), also known as clinical depression, is a mental disorder characterized by at least two weeks of pervasive depression (mood), low mood, low self-esteem, and anhedonia, loss of interest or pleasure in normally ...
, super-refractory status epilepticus, and essential tremor, but development for these indications was discontinued. It has been suggested that allopregnanolone and its precursor pregnenolone may have therapeutic potential for treatment of various symptoms of alcohol use disorders by restoring deficits in GABAergic inhibition, moderating corticotropin releasing factor (CRF) signaling, and inhibiting excessive neuroimmune activation. Many co-occurring symptoms of ethanol addiction (e.g., anxiety, depression, seizures, sleep disturbance, pain) that are believed to contribute to the downward spiral of the addiction may also be controlled with neuroactive steroids. Exogenous progesterone, such as
oral The word oral may refer to: Relating to the mouth * Relating to the mouth, the first portion of the alimentary canal that primarily receives food and liquid **Oral administration of medicines ** Oral examination (also known as an oral exam or ora ...
progesterone, elevates allopregnanolone levels in the body with good dose-to-serum level correlations. Due to this, it has been suggested that oral progesterone could be described as a
prodrug A prodrug is a pharmacologically inactive medication or compound that, after intake, is metabolized (i.e., converted within the body) into a pharmacologically active drug. Instead of administering a drug directly, a corresponding prodrug can be ...
of sorts for allopregnanolone. As a result, there has been some interest in using oral progesterone to treat catamenial epilepsy, as well as other menstrual cycle-related and neurosteroid-associated conditions. In addition to oral progesterone, oral pregnenolone has also been found to act as a prodrug of allopregnanolone, though also of pregnenolone sulfate. In animal models of
traumatic brain injury A traumatic brain injury (TBI), also known as an intracranial injury, is an injury to the brain caused by an external force. TBI can be classified based on severity ranging from mild traumatic brain injury (mTBI/concussion) to severe traumati ...
, allopregnanolone has been shown to reduce inflammation by attenuating the production of proinflammatory cytokines (IL-1β and TNF-α) at 3 h after the injury. It has also been shown to reduce the severity of brain damage and improve cognitive function and recovery.
